The Stellantis factory in Kénitra is preparing to assemble the future Fiat Fastback and Grizzly. This major strategic project aims to supply Europe, Africa and the Middle East from the second half of 2026.

To counter the offensive of Chinese manufacturers and recapture market share in Europe, the automotive group is now relying on the competitiveness of its Moroccan ecosystem. This industrial choice must secure profit margins in the highly competitive segment of affordable family vehicles, as part of a long-term strategy that plans the deployment of 60 new models by 2030.

The future Fastback and Grizzly will thus share a common platform capable of integrating conventional thermal engines as well as 100% electric powertrains. The first model will stand out with an expressive silhouette with sleek lines, while the second will offer a more vertical architecture focused on space and practicality.

This acceleration results from an expansion plan of 1.2 billion euros unveiled in July 2025. This massive capital injection allows the factory capacity to reach 535,000 vehicles per year, confirming the site’s central place in global automotive manufacturing, according to Challenge.

The Kénitra infrastructure thus consolidates already proven expertise. The platform currently ensures the production of the Peugeot 208 and has specialized in the assembly of electric quadricycles, such as the Citroën Ami, Opel Rocks-e and Fiat Topolino.
